The discussions about SAR values and abandoned mine water <br />contamination in Section 4.05.1 should be modified to show the <br />changes in these conditions based on the dry mine operation <br />,i plan. These changes should be consistant with the discussions <br />in Sections 2.04 and 2.05. <br />The discussion of water quality standards and effluent <br />limitations in section 4.05.2 should be modified to reflect the <br />deletion of abandoned mine dewatering in the dry mine plan. <br />The operator may provide evidence that the dewatering plan <br />should be retained in the event that poor quality abandoned <br />mine drainage is intercepted. Because of the inaccuracy in <br />predicting the extent of old mine workings it is still possible <br />that bad water could be encountered even under the dry mine <br />operations plan. <br />d. The statement in paragraph 3, page 4.05-5 should be modified to <br />discuss erosion control methodologies for ditches excavated in <br />v highly erosive soils. Field observation indicates that <br />management of erosion is necessary in the western diversion <br />ditch, and may be required in other ditches as well. <br />e. The discussion of toxic spoil in Section 4.05.8 should be <br />~- expanded. The discussion should reflect the dry mine plan, and <br />be consistant with the Division's findings document. <br />f. All references to use of, or following Wyoming DEQ Guidelines <br />on soil placement and sampling during reclamation should be <br />changed to a statement such as "handling techniques will be <br />patterned after Wyoming DEQ or other pertinent guidelines". A <br />direct reference to the use of these guidelines should not be <br />made, as they are not formally accepted by the State of <br />Colorado. Such references are found in Sections 2.04 and 4.06. <br />g. 4.07.3 An additional statement should be added that calls for <br />abandonment reports as per Stipulation No. 17. <br />h. A discussion of the new regulations pertaining to certification <br />of blasting supervisors should be included in Section 4.08. <br />~/ i. A discussion of the approved loadout (TR-03) should be inserted <br />in Section 4.28, replacing the existing text. <br />IV. Maps and Accessory Documents (Volumes 2, 3 and 4) <br />a. The operator must review and revise all maps as necessary to <br />reflect the approved dry mine plan. All indications of the <br />~ multiple seam plan should be eradicated from these maps. The <br />exploration test pit should be included on all appropriate maps. <br />The Division will review the revised maps when submitted, and will <br />then be able to address specific adequacy questions to each map. <br />
